cmd 运行set http_proxy
时间: 2023-11-09 12:08:02 浏览: 47
该命令用于在 Windows 命令提示符中设置 HTTP 代理。如果您需要使用代理服务器来访问 Internet,可以使用此命令将代理服务器配置为 Windows 系统的默认代理。
请按照以下步骤执行:
1. 打开命令提示符(按下 Win+R 键,输入 cmd 并按下 Enter)。
2. 在命令提示符中输入以下命令并按下 Enter:
`set http_proxy=http://yourproxyaddress:yourproxyport`
其中,yourproxyaddress 是代理服务器的 IP 地址或主机名,yourproxyport 是代理服务器的端口号。
3. 如果您需要使用代理服务器的用户名和密码,请将其添加到命令中:
`set http_proxy=http://username:password@yourproxyaddress:yourproxyport`
4. 您可以使用以下命令验证代理服务器是否已正确设置:
`echo %http_proxy%`
相关问题
export http_proxy=http://10.16.150.231:8099 怎么设置
### 回答1:
这句命令是在设置一个环境变量,表示 HTTP 代理服务器的地址为 "http://10.16.150.231:8099"。具体使用方法如下:
1. 打开命令行窗口。
2. 输入 "export http_proxy=http://10.16.150.231:8099",并回车。
3. 环境变量就设置完成了。
注意这设置的是 Linux or MacOS 系统的设置方式,Windows 系统设置可以在命令提示符窗口中键入 set http_proxy=http://10.16.150.231:8099。
### 回答2:
要设置 `export http_proxy=http://10.16.150.231:8099`,可以按照以下步骤进行操作:
1. 打开终端或命令行窗口。
2. 输入`export http_proxy=http://10.16.150.231:8099`命令。
3. 按下回车键确认命令执行。
上述命令将设置一个环境变量 `http_proxy`,其值为 `http://10.16.150.231:8099`,这表示该代理服务器将会被用于所有的 HTTP 请求。代理服务器的 IP 地址为 `10.16.150.231`,端口号为 `8099`。
请注意,在执行上述命令之前,确保代理服务器的 IP 地址和端口号是正确的,并且你有权访问该代理服务器。此外,如果你有其他协议的代理服务器,比如 HTTPS 或 FTP,你也可以通过设置其他环境变量(如 `https_proxy` 或 `ftp_proxy`)来指定相应的代理服务器。
### 回答3:
要设置 export http_proxy=http://10.16.150.231:8099,请按照以下步骤进行操作:
1.打开终端窗口或命令提示符:在Windows上,可以按下Win+R键,然后输入“cmd”并按Enter键;在Mac上,可以按下Command+Space键,然后输入“Terminal”并按Enter键。
2.键入以下命令:export http_proxy=http://10.16.150.231:8099,并按Enter键。这将设置http_proxy环境变量为指定的代理服务器地址和端口。
3.如果没有出现错误提示,则表示设置成功。你现在可以使用设置的代理服务器进行网络请求。
请注意,这个设置仅在当前的终端会话中生效。如果你想在每次启动终端时都自动应用该设置,可以将以上命令添加到你的bash配置文件中(例如,~/.bashrc或~/.bash_profile)。在Windows上,你也可以使用“环境变量”设置持久化的环境变量。
另外,确保你设置的代理服务器地址和端口是正确的,并且你拥有访问该代理服务器的权限。如果代理服务器需要用户名和密码进行验证,你需要在设置时提供相应的凭据(例如,export http_proxy=http://username:password@10.16.150.231:8099)。
希望以上解答对你有所帮助!
更正这个Python代码import rospy from mavros_msgs.msg import State from mavros_msgs.srv import CommandBool, SetMode from geometry_msgs.msg import PoseStamped import time current_state = State() def state_cb(msg): global current_state current_state = msg rospy.init_node('position') rate = rospy.Rate(20.0) state_sub = rospy.Subscriber("mavros/state", State, state_cb) local_pos_pub = rospy.Publisher("mavros/setpoint_position/local", PoseStamped, queue_size=10) arming_client = rospy.ServiceProxy("mavros/cmd/arming", CommandBool) set_mode_client = rospy.ServiceProxy("mavros/set_mode", SetMode) wait for FCU connection while not rospy.is_shutdown() and not current_state.connected: rate.sleep() pose = PoseStamped() pose.pose.position.x = 0 pose.pose.position.y = 0 pose.pose.position.z = 1.5 offb_set_mode = SetMode() offb_set_mode.custom_mode = "OFFBOARD" arm_cmd = CommandBool() arm_cmd.value = True state = 3 last_request = rospy.Time.now() while not rospy.is_shutdown() and (rospy.Time.now() - last_request < rospy.Duration(5.0)): if not current_state.armed: if arming_client(arm_cmd) and arm_cmd.response.success: rospy.loginfo("Vehicle armed") if current_state.mode != "OFFBOARD": if set_mode_client(offb_set_mode) and offb_set_mode.response.mode_sent: rospy.loginfo("Offboard enabled") rate.sleep() while state > 0: last_request = rospy.Time.now() while not rospy.is_shutdown() and (rospy.Time.now() - last_request < rospy.Duration(5.0)): pose.pose.position.x = 0 pose.pose.position.y = 0 local_pos_pub.publish(pose) rospy.loginfo("SUCCESS0") rate.sleep() last_request = rospy.Time.now() while not rospy.is_shutdown() and (rospy.Time.now() - last_request < rospy.Duration(5.0)): pose.pose.position.x = 2 pose.pose.position.y = 2 local_pos_pub.publish(pose) rospy.loginfo("SUCCESS1") rate.sleep() state -= 1 rospy.loginfo("state=" + str(state)) offb_set_mode.custom_mode = "AUTO.LAND" if set_mode_client(offb_set_mode) and offb_set_mode.response.mode_sent: rospy.loginfo("AUTO.LAND enabled") last_request = rospy.Time.now() rospy.spin()
这段 Python 代码主要是控制飞行器执行一定的动作。代码中,首先通过导入 rospy、mavros_msgs.msg、mavros_msgs.srv、geometry_msgs.msg 等模块,定义了一些变量和函数。
然后,在 while 循环中,程序会等待与飞控系统的连接建立,之后会设置飞行器的起飞高度为 1.5 米,然后进入一个 while 循环,其中会执行飞行器的上升和向右移动,最后执行自动降落的任务。
其中,offb_set_mode.custom_mode = "OFFBOARD" 会将飞行器的模式设置为 OFFBOARD,arm_cmd.value = True 会将飞行器的电机解锁,local_pos_pub.publish(pose) 会将飞行器的位置信息发布到话题中,set_mode_client(offb_set_mode) 会将飞行器的模式切换为指定的模式,arming_client(arm_cmd) 会将飞行器的电机锁定或解锁。